public static String getValue(String options, String key, String defaultValue) {
key = trimKey(key);
key += '=';
int index=-1;
do { // Require that key not be preceded by a letter
index = options.indexOf(key, ++index);
if (index<0) return defaultValue;
} while (index!=0&&Character.isLetter(options.charAt(index-1)));
options = options.substring(index+key.length(), options.length());
if (options.charAt(0)=='\'') {
index = options.indexOf("'",1);
if (index<0)
return defaultValue;
else
return options.substring(1, index);
} else if (options.charAt(0)=='[') {
index = options.indexOf("]",1);
if (index<0)
return defaultValue;
else
return options.substring(1, index);
} else {
//if (options.indexOf('=')==-1) {
// options = options.trim();
// IJ.log("getValue: "+key+" |"+options+"|");
// if (options.length()>0)
// return options;
// else
// return defaultValue;
//}
index = options.indexOf(" ");
if (index<0)
return defaultValue;
else
return options.substring(0, index);
}
}
public static String trimKey(String key) {
int index = key.indexOf(" ");
if (index>-1)
key = key.substring(0,index);
index = key.indexOf(":");
if (index>-1)
key = key.substring(0,index);
key = key.toLowerCase(Locale.US);
return key;
}
